8 CALIBRATION

This section describes a method of performing a multi-point calibration of the Model 300M CO Analyzer and a method of performing a zero-span check.

8.1 Required Equipment and Gas Standards

Zero air must be free of CO (less than 0.1 PPM of CO).

CAUTION

Be careful when pulling in outside air particularly if outside humidity and temperature are high. Condensation may result which can lead to unstable operation, or at worst, water contamination in the cell.

Calibration gas concentrations must be generated from an NIST-traceable cylinder of CO -in-air. Carrier air for transporting the CO must be the same as the zero air. A suggested calibration gas generating system is shown in Figure 8-1.

The materials in the calibration gas delivery system should be stainless steel, TFE and FEP (Teflon). The system must be clean.

The calibration gas delivery system (or manifold) must be properly vented to a suitable vent outside the analyzer area and near the analyzer inlet to avoid imposing a pressure or vacuum at the inlet. The recommended venting method is shown in Figure 8-2.
